Maximizing Earnings: How to Sell Your Domains

Owning a domain name can be a gold mine, but it's only truly profitable when you know how to capitalize on its worth. Selling your domains is a skillful endeavor that requires careful strategy. First, determine the market worth of your domain.

Consider factors like length, relevance, and keywords as well as industry demand. Once you have a clear picture, it's time to showcase your domain on reputable marketplaces. Develop a compelling profile that emphasizes the unique features of your domain. Remember to stay persistent and connect with potential buyers to increase your chances of a successful sale.
